Linux 基础 之 lvm 逻辑卷管理

linux系统里,文件系统需要被挂载后才可以被使用

lvm没有分区限制,分一个物理分区,建立一个物理卷,然后这个物理卷建立一个卷组,我们就可以在这个卷组里面去分无数个逻辑卷,而且逻辑卷可以随意扩大缩小,不会对物理分 区有影响,逻辑卷的功能也和物理分区差不多,一样可以格式化成随意的文件系统,挂载到随意的目录。

lvm的主要功能
从硬盘驱动器中创建物理卷(physical volumes-PV)。
从物理卷中创建卷组(volume groups-VG)。
从卷组中创建逻辑卷(logical volumes-LV),并分派逻辑卷挂载点
其中只有逻辑卷才可以写数据

就像金箍棒,想大就大,想小就小。
使硬盘无限分区,扩容。

物理分区、pv、vg、pE、lvm、/mnt ;
pv 处理后的物理分区,为物理卷,处于lvm最底层,可以是物理硬盘或者分区 ;
vg 物理卷组,建立在pv之上,可以含有一个到多个pv ;
pE 是vg的最小单位 。

[root@localhost ~]# pvcreate /dev/vdb1                  ##创建物理卷
  Physical volume "/dev/vdb1" successfully created
[root@localhost ~]# vgcreate vg0 /dev/vdb1              ##创建物理卷组
  Volume group "vg0" successfully created
[root@localhost ~]# lvcreate -L 300M -n lv0 vg0         ##创建逻辑卷
  Logical volume "lv0" created
[root@localhost ~]# mkfs.xfs /dev/vg0/lv0               ##格式化

一、逻辑卷的扩容
(目的使扩大系统的储存容量)

xfs系统:
情况一、vg足够拉伸
[root@localhost ~]# lvextend -L 500M /dev/vg0/lv0     ##扩大系统 
  Extending logical volume lv0 to 500.00 MiB
  Logical volume lv0 successfully resized
[root@localhost ~]# xfs_growfs /dev/vg0/lv0   ##扩展文件系统

data blocks changed from 76800 to 128000

情况二、vg不够拉伸,得先扩大设备,在扩大系统。
[root@localhost ~]# pvcreate /dev/vdb2
  Physical volume "/dev/vdb2" successfully created
[root@localhost ~]# vgextend vg0 /dev/vdb2               ##添加物理卷到物理卷组
  Volume group "vg0" successfully extended
[root@localhost ~]# lvextend -L 1500M /dev/vg0/lv0       ##划分物理卷 & 扩展逻辑卷大小
  Extending logical volume lv0 to 1.46 GiB
  Logical volume lv0 successfully resized

二、逻辑卷的缩容
(目的使缩小系统的储存容量)
注意:xfs系统没有缩容。

ext4系统:
[root@localhost ~]# umount /mnt/                       ##卸载
[root@localhost ~]# e2fsck  -f /dev/vg0/lv0            ##扫描逻辑卷上的空间

[root@localhost ~]# resize2fs  /dev/vg0/lv0  1000M                            ##缩系统到1000M
resize2fs 1.42.9 (28-Dec-2013)
Resizing the filesystem on /dev/vg0/lv0 to 256000 (4k) blocks.
The filesystem on /dev/vg0/lv0 is now 256000 blocks long.

[root@localhost ~]# mount /dev/vg0/lv0 /mnt/                                   ##挂载
[root@localhost ~]# lvreduce -L 1000M /dev/vg0/lv0                             ##缩设备
  WARNING: Reducing active and open logical volume to 1000.00 MiB
  THIS MAY DESTROY YOUR DATA (filesystem etc.)
Do you really want to reduce lv0? [y/n]: y
  Reducing logical volume lv0 to 1000.00 MiB
  Logical volume lv0 successfully resized

这里写图片描述

缩减vg:
(迁移到闲置设备)

[root@localhost ~]# pvmove /dev/vdb1 /dev/vdb2        ##将vdb1内的数据移到vdb2中
  /dev/vdb1: Moved: 88.0%
  /dev/vdb1: Moved: 100.0%
[root@localhost ~]# vgreduce vg0 /dev/vdb1            ##再将vdb1从vg0中取出来
  Removed "/dev/vdb1" from volume group "vg0"
[root@localhost ~]# pvremove /dev/vdb1                ##删除vdb1
  Labels on physical volume "/dev/vdb1" successfully wiped

报错:

[root@localhost ~]# pvmove /dev/vdb1 /dev/vdb2
  Insufficient free space: 249 extents needed, but only 248 available
  Unable to allocate mirror extents for pvmove0.
  Failed to convert pvmove LV to mirrored

vdb1 缩的不够小,vdb2容不下。所以说,得再重新缩小vdb1.

删除设备:

[root@localhost ~]# umount /mnt/                                       ##卸载/mnt
[root@localhost ~]# lvremove /dev/vg0/lv0backup                        ##删除快照
Do you really want to remove active logical volume lv0backup? [y/n]: y
  Logical volume "lv0backup" successfully removed
[root@localhost ~]# lvremove  /dev/vg0/lv0                             ##删除逻辑卷
Do you really want to remove active logical volume lv0? [y/n]: y
  Logical volume "lv0" successfully removed
[root@localhost ~]# vgremove vg0                                       ##删除物理卷组
  Volume group "vg0" successfully removed
[root@localhost ~]# pvremove /dev/vdb2                                 ##删除物理卷
  Labels on physical volume "/dev/vdb2" successfully wiped
